From 7c74f6556abbc299a79b1490c06151a43c902f61 Mon Sep 17 00:00:00 2001 From: Gabor Kiss-Vamosi Date: Fri, 18 Mar 2022 14:10:27 +0100 Subject: [PATCH] fix(scroll): fix scroll to view to the left fixes #3158 --- src/core/lv_obj_scroll.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/core/lv_obj_scroll.c b/src/core/lv_obj_scroll.c index 6927acace..cb43511bd 100644 --- a/src/core/lv_obj_scroll.c +++ b/src/core/lv_obj_scroll.c @@ -746,7 +746,7 @@ static void scroll_area_into_view(const lv_area_t * area, lv_obj_t * child, lv_p x_scroll = left_diff; /*Do not let scrolling in*/ lv_coord_t sl = lv_obj_get_scroll_left(parent); - if(sl + x_scroll > 0) x_scroll = 0; + if(sl - x_scroll < 0) x_scroll = 0; } else if(right_diff > 0) { x_scroll = -right_diff;